Under general supervision, directly supports the fabrication and machining of structures. Position will utilize tooling, fixtures, handling systems, safety, quality checks, inspection, ergonomics, and other duties as assigned.

Uses various tools provided in the work area to perform machining duties including but not limited to:

  • Safely load/unload structures and perform advanced quality checks at the advanced machining cells.
  • Operate the advanced machining center, following standard work instructions
  • Ability to perform perishable/durable cutting tool setup, maintenance and replacement of inserts, drills, taps as needed
  • Ability to perform TPM, basic error recovery, pallet change, tool changer, and error trouble shooting
  • Inspects own work quality utilizing gages, micrometers, etc.
  • Make basic machine program changes
Job Responsibility
  • Use of lifting devices to move heavy components of weights of more than 35 lbs to position heavy fabricated metal components in machining fixtures.
  • Basic rework by changing a single axis offset at assigned home cell
  • General knowledge of manufacturing, methods, and processes
  • Rotation to various positions within the Job Function area to perform related activities
  • Ability to perform routine maintenance (TPM, Coolant Concentration)
  • Rotation to various positions within the Job Function area to perform related activities.
Physical Requirements:
  • Willing and able to sit or stand for prolonged periods
  • Willing and able to perform repetitive operation
  • Willing and able to lift up to 35 lbs.
Required Qualifications
  • At least one year of Machinist experience
